Transaction 585df70ed0585c75b758e0eb30edff5738439ac52bf6677da976f0478a8c3161
1 Input
2 Outputs
- 585df70ed0585c75b758e0eb30edff5738439ac52bf6677da976f0478a8c3161:0
- 585df70ed0585c75b758e0eb30edff5738439ac52bf6677da976f0478a8c3161:1
value 19786563
address 1P5dZXsTZJn5hgz5bGkmfJxuYJzsAiihvQ
value 863032
address 1NBov3BDXDQPa1gxx5YT8C9byAugBGn7ec